Since you're not tall enough to do the usual big agency stuff there is an agency here in Toronto that has lots of Russian girls, Ukrane etc, called Rouge. The girls get work with rock videos, trade show, film, etc.

Strangely enough the free lance market here seems very small. In Paris lots of models are freelance and it works fine. In Toronto not at all.

When I'm in Paris girls come from all over the place and funny here in Toronto I have girls coming from the US, yet no local girls even ask.....

Lots of great photographers.

However you can't work with them unless you have an open work permit.
Student visa may allow you to work some, but you should double-check.
A work permit just for modelling will have restrictions on which jobs you can do, and I doubt you have that as you would need an agency to bankroll and deal with that process, meaning you would not be confused about the industry.
A work permit based on a different job you've gotten in Canada will not allow you to model. Not even TF.

If you're just moving to Canada, I hope it's to get married, or you really cannot work with anyone, not even for trade.
Most people worth working with won't touch you unless you're legal, and I would suggest not putting yourself or others into a possibly dangerous legal debacle even if they do.
